Always Be True and Faithful (German: Üb' immer Treu' und Redlichkeit ) is a 1927 German silent film directed by Reinhold Schünzel and starring Reinhold Schünzel, Rosa Valetti and Julius E. Herrmann.[1]
The film's sets were designed by the art directors Emil Hasler and Oscar Friedrich Werndorff.
